STYLI Raises Funds for Saudi Arabia's Children with Disabilities Association
• STYLI’s funds to Children with Disabilities Association will go towards providing aid to approximately 4,000 children across the Kingdom during the month of Ramadan.
 
• The donation is part of Landmark Group’s commitment to support and empower communities across the region.
 
Riyadh, Saudi Arabia - 21, April 2022 – STYLI, Landmark Group’s online-only fast fashion brand, has successfully raised over SAR 100,000 for Children with Disability Association (CDA) to support children across the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ia and make a significant difference to their lives. 
 
The funds were handed over at a recent ceremony held at the association in the presence of Menon Unnikrishnan, General Manager of STYLI and Dr. Ahmad Tamimi, Executive Director of the Children with Disabilites Association.
 
With a growing importance of addressing disabilities across the Kingdom, STYLI’s donation is part of its commitment to support humanitarian organisations in Saudi Arabia to improve the lives of thousands of children.
 
Commenting on the partnership, Menon Unnikrishnan, General Manager of STYLI, said: “We are immensely proud of this achievement and to be able to make our contribution towards improving the lives of disabled children and the wider community in the Kingdom. Our philanthropic efforts were made possible by the generous donations of STYLI customers. Our partnership with CDA is in line with STYLI’s CSR efforts in the Kingdom and we will continue to support the CDA and other similar organizations that contribute to the well-being and social welfare of Saudi citizens.” 
 
During the visit, an agreement was signed to support CDA with donations and clothes during the holy month of Ramadan.
 
Dr. Ahmad Tamimi, Executive Director of the Children with Disabilities Association (CDA) said: “As an entity working to maximize the quality of life through rehabilitation and education for disabled children in Saudi Arabia, such partnerships provide a significant relief to our cause, helping us continue to aid approximately 4,000 children in our care in the Kingdom. We look forward to continue working with STYLI by thanking them and their customers for the generosity they have shown.”
 
The partnership between CDA & STYLI is part of Landmark Group’s commitment to enrich and empower communities across the GCC and initiating a positive change for societies.
